Nadia wasn't rolling in cash, but she now had six people who called her regularly.

There was even a guy on campus who had two kids. Nadia never realized that people who came to finish their education actually had kids like that till she started babysitting them. Four out of the six kids Nadia looked after had real bad behavior, and no proper home training.

They all ranged from ages 2 to 6.

MIkey was by far the best kid she'd ever babysat. He was quiet, calm, and just as sweet as he could be. Nadia would babysit him any day, over anybody. Nadia was starting to get closer with Faye each time she babysat Mikey.

Faye was 22, and she really balanced Nadia out. Faye wanted to be a pediatric doctor for kids like Mikey. Faye still strongly felt that there was something wrong with Mikey, but he was just to young for it to be seen.

Faye wanted to be the doctor to actually look deeper than most at babies. You may think there is nothing wrong, but there might be.

To Nadia, Mikey just seemed like that was just his personality.

He was just ultra laid back. Faye disagreed though. Nadia was making 40 to 60 dollars daily. Though it wasn't a lot. She had something. Nadia had thought about staying at a hotel, but the cost of one daily down in Florida ranged from 44.00 to 88.00 dollars a night.

Nadia still had to eat everyday, and get gas to drive when some one called for her to baby sit.

Nadia was actually fine with getting well acquainted with her car. It was small and an ugly color, but it was comfortable. She finally did buy a car charger, but it would only charge if the car was on, and she couldn't go to sleep with her car running.

So she cut her conversations short with Jodi, Shawn, and now Faye.

Faye often talked about Shawn. Nadia didn't mention that she knew him personally, but Faye spoke freely of him, she had it real bad for him. Faye admire his dedication, and maturity.

A lot of people at the school did though. Shawn was an attractive, young black male, doing the most, and being congratulated for his all his early achievements. Shawn really wasn't playing about his future, or doing the best he could for his son.

Despite his popularity with the females, and also males at the school Shawn really wasn't stunnin' nobody. He was cool with everybody, but nobody had reached under his surface like Nadia had.

Though there was that Nadia had thought about letting Faye, and Shawn meet. Faye seemed perfect for him.

He had a kid, and Faye had a kid. They both strived to do what was best for them and their kids. While Nadia was struggling with money, and living in her car. Nadia felt like Shawn wouldn't want someone like her.

                                             ..If he only he really knew what was going on..

Nadia's time with her lies were up when she woke up one early morning to see Shawn staring at her through the driver window.

She could lie, and say she'd fell asleep, but how could she also explain about the all shit that over followed her tiny car.

She could say she was lazy, but Shawn did not find laziness attractive.

Nadia held the button down for the window while Shawn just quietly stared at her -- making her feel ashamed about her situation. Nadia blinked away the tears that burned her eyes. Shawn just shook his head reaching out he wiped her eyes.
